编译工具挤爆 C 盘?用 mklink 一招解决

不知大家有没遇到这种情况,在搭建某些代码的编译环境的时候,发现编译工具是指定目录的,比如c:xxxx,如果工具比较小便罢了,但如果是几个G甚至更大的,这让人难以接受。

好在Windows内置了一个mklink命令,可用于创建文件或文件夹的符号链接。下面看一下该命令的使用:

基本语法很简单:mklink [[/D] | [/H] | [/J]] link target

  • • /D 创建目录符号链接(最常用)
  • • /J 创建目录联接
  • • 什么都不加则创建文件符号链接

举个例子,假如存放编译工具的文件夹是 D:BuildToolsPython37,但是要求要把编译工具放在 c:python3,只需以管理员身份运行命令提示符,执行:

mklink /d c:python3 D:BuildToolsPython37即可在 C 盘便创建一个指向原目录的文件夹。

这样我们可以把所有编译工具整合到一个文件夹下,然后根据需求,通过命令去创建链接,不仅解决了前面所说的文件空间占用问题,还可以规整自己的编译工具,方便管理。

有两点需要提示一下:一是删除链接时直接在资源管理器里右键删除即可,不会影响原文件;二是创建链接需要管理员权限,如果遇上权限不足记得右键"以管理员身份运行"命令提示符。

 

 

 

版权声明:
作者:bin
链接:https://ay123.net/notebook/experience/1918/
来源:爱影博客
文章版权归作者所有,未经允许请勿转载。

THE END
分享
二维码
海报
编译工具挤爆 C 盘?用 mklink 一招解决
不知大家有没遇到这种情况,在搭建某些代码的编译环境的时候,发现编译工具是指定目录的,比如c:xxxx,如果工具比较小便罢了,但如果是几个G甚至更大的,这让……
<<上一篇
下一篇>>
文章目录
关闭
目 录